Picking In Between New Building And Construction and Existing Houses available: Factors to Think about
When searching for a home, one of the main choices you'll deal with is whether to buy brand-new construction or an existing home. Each choice provides one-of-a-kind benefits and considerations that can influence your choice. This guide discovers the factors to think about when picking between new building and existing homes offer for sale, helping you make an informed choice that straightens with your choices and way of life.

1. Expense and Pricing
Price is a significant variable when comparing new building and construction and existing homes. While new building and construction homes might come with greater initial price, existing homes can entail additional expenses for improvements and repair work.

Expense Factors to consider:

New Building: Typically priced higher because of contemporary features, energy-efficient attributes, and customization options.
Existing Homes: May require remodellings or updates, which can add to the total price of possession.
2. Personalization and Personalization
New construction homes use the advantage of customization, permitting you to pick layout, surfaces, and includes that match your choices. Existing homes, while they may require renovations, frequently have unique charm and personality.

Customization Options:

New Construction: Pick design, flooring, cabinetry, devices, and other layout elements to individualize your home.
Existing Homes: Refurbish or update existing functions to reflect your design and choices.
3. Power Performance and Modern Facilities
Brand-new building homes are often constructed with energy-efficient materials and innovations, which can cause lower utility costs and environmental advantages. Existing homes may need upgrades to attain similar effectiveness.

Power Efficiency and Features:

New Building And Construction: Energy Star-rated home appliances, progressed insulation, and HVAC systems made for efficiency.
Existing Homes: Potential for upgrades such as energy-efficient windows, appliances, and insulation.
4. Maintenance and Repairs
Maintenance demands differ between new building and existing homes. New building homes normally feature warranties that cover major systems and architectural parts, while existing homes might need instant or future repair services.

Upkeep Considerations:

New Building: Limited maintenance at first because of new systems and materials; warranty protection for structural concerns.
Existing Houses: Possible for instant fixings or updates; continuous maintenance requirements based upon the home's age and condition.
5. Place and Community
Take into consideration the area and community qualities when picking between brand-new construction and existing homes. Existing homes might use recognized communities with fully grown landscaping and facilities, while brand-new building and construction developments may provide contemporary features and prepared neighborhood functions.

Area Factors:

Existing Homes: Established communities with institutions, parks, and regional services; closeness to cultural and leisure destinations.
New Construction: Planned neighborhoods with services like parks, strolling tracks, recreation center, and modern facilities.
6. Timeline and Move-In Ready
The timeline for acquiring and relocating right into a home ranges new construction and existing homes. Brand-new building and construction homes may require longer lead times because of building timetables, while existing homes can offer quicker move-in options.

Timeline Considerations:

New Construction: Depending upon the phase of construction, timelines may vary from numerous months to over a year; chance for modification throughout the construct procedure.
Existing Houses: Normally offered for instant occupancy; quicker closing timelines contrasted to new building and construction.
7. Resale Worth and Market Trends
Think about the resale value possibility and market trends for both brand-new building and existing homes. Market need, area, and home problem can influence future resale possibilities.

Resale Factors to consider:

New Construction: Possible for higher first resale value because of modern attributes and service warranties; market demand for new homes in expanding locations.
Existing Residences: Resale worth affected by place, condition, and updates; potential for historical appreciation in established areas.
8. Builder Online Reputation and Top Quality
When selecting new construction, research study the contractor's credibility and top quality of workmanship. Evaluations, testimonials, and previous tasks can supply insights right into the builder's track record and consumer fulfillment.

Contractor Considerations:

Online reputation: Evaluation builder qualifications, certifications, and consumer comments; visit design homes and finished projects.
Quality Control: Assess building and construction materials, surfaces, and interest to information; inquire about guarantee insurance coverage and customer support.
9. Personal Preferences and Lifestyle
Ultimately, the decision in between brand-new building and construction and existing homes depends on your personal preferences, way of life, and long-lasting objectives. Consider factors such as design preferences, area services, and financial considerations when making your choice.

Personal Considerations:

Layout Aesthetic: Preference for modern layouts and features versus traditional building designs.
Neighborhood Environment: Desire for intended amenities, community occasions, and homeowner organizations (HOAs) versus developed communities with distinct character.
Long-Term Goals: Take into consideration exactly how the home aligns with your future strategies, including family members development, career adjustments, and retired life.
10. Assessment with Property Professionals
Deal with a licensed realty agent that specializes in new building or existing homes to guide your decision-making procedure. They can offer market understandings, negotiate in your place, and promote a smooth deal from start to finish.

Advantages of Real Estate Representatives:

Expertise: Expertise of local market patterns, areas, and residential property values.
Settlement: Experience in bargaining acquisition terms, rate changes, and backups.
Transaction Administration: Support with examinations, assessments, and shutting procedures.
